The Teatro Colón's Experimental Center is hosting "A orillas de sí misma," a theatrical experience described as both original and fascinating, which delves into the possibilities of sound in performance. This production, a coproduction between Paraíso Club and the Experimental Center, stands in contrast to the visually dominant theater prevalent today, focusing instead on how sound can generate images, meanings, connections, bodies, and spaces.

Conceived by director Ciro Zorzoli, the work is based on "Arroyo," a 2021 novel by actress Susana Pampín. The play translates the author's narrative voice into a collective, diverse ensemble of eighteen actors who sing and perform the story. Marcela Guerty leads the cast as the primary narrator.

The production is structured into ten scenes, each corresponding to a chapter of the novel. It follows the protagonist, Gaby, through various vacation periods in the Tigre Delta between January 2003 and December 2018. Gaby, who loves another woman, navigates a fluctuating relationship with her mother and sisters. Her experiences are deeply intertwined with the natural yet unpredictable landscape of the Delta, captivating her with its dense waters, diverse birdlife, plants, fruits, and local inhabitants.

"A orillas de sí misma" highlights the small, everyday moments that bring Gaby happiness and a sense of escape: spontaneous swims, afternoon naps, the ritual of drinking mate, kayak trips, and thunderstorms. These simple occurrences, experienced once or twice a year, provide her with profound contentment and allow her to momentarily forget her troubles.
